Akkies tame Animals

Leeds Akkies Masters sent the Political Animals scurrying back to Westminster with their tails between their legs on Saturday.

in a game played on the fantastic new 3G pitch at Leeds Rhinos' training complex the Akkies ran in six tries to the politicians' three.

Ben Wardleworth contributed two characteristic long-range efforts, with Ian Dalby also adding his name to the scoresheet and topping the penalty count. The Akkies also handed debuts to ex-Loughborough University halfback Dave Needham and Wales Students centre Danny Thomas - both of whom will be hoping to play first grade rugby in 2012 - and the duo also crossed the whitewash, with Thomas claiming a long-range brace.

The Animals fielded Akkies president Greg Mulholland MP and former England International winger Ikram Butt. Their tries came from hooker Richard Heaton (2) and prop forward John Prescott.
